Essential Functions, Duties & Responsibilities:
- Assemble/Setup new implements and equipment arriving into the dealership
- Clean and detail new/used equipment
- Complete work orders and paperwork regarding daily maintenance and repair duties
- Assist Service Technicians as needed, to include performing basic maintenance on Company equipment, delivery of parts, repairing, servicing, and moving equipment
- General lot maintenance – keeping the lot organized and tidy, maintaining the lawn, parking lot, and equipment displays
- General building maintenance – preventative projects to maintain cleanliness, appearance, and safety of the facility
- Clean, organize, and maintain the condition of the shop, inventory, tools, and equipment
- Equipment staging for customer events
- General background knowledge of all equipment/machinery available through the dealership for ease of operation and maintenance
- Adhere to and enforce all safety regulations and wear all safety equipment as required
- Participate in training as assigned
- Work effectively and cooperatively with peers and management
- Other duties as assigned
